Tottenham Hotspur team news: Injury, suspension list vs. Red Star Belgrade

Spurs injury, suspension list vs. Red Star

Tottenham Hotspur will be desperate to claim their first away victory of the 2019-20 campaign when they take on Red Star Belgrade in the Champions League on Wednesday night.

Mauricio Pochettino's men must rouse themselves following the disappointment of conceding a 97th-minute equaliser against Everton in the Premier League on Sunday.

The North London side will be encouraged by the fact that a win over Red Star, whom they beat 5-0 at home last month, would take them to within one victory of qualifying for the knockout phase.

Here, Sports Mole rounds up Tottenham's latest injuries and suspensions ahead of this fixture.


Hugo Lloris

Status: Out Type of injury: Elbow Possible return date: Unknown

The Spurs captain damaged ligaments in his elbow last month following what immediately looked like a bad landing and is not expected to return to action until 2020.


Harry Kane

Status: Minor doubt Type of injury: Illness Possible return date: November 6 (vs. Red Star Belgrade)

The Englishman was expected to feature against Everton but pulled out at the 11th hour due to illness, but he is anticipated to return to the starting XI in Belgrade.


Jan Vertonghen

Status: Minor doubt Type of injury: Hamstring Possible return date: November 6 (vs. Red Star Belgrade)

Vertonghen picked up a slight hamstring strain which ruled him out of the trip to Goodison Park but the injury is not thought to be serious, with the Belgian set to travel with the squad this week.


TOTTENHAM HOTSPUR'S SUSPENSION LIST

While Danny Rose and Son Heung-min are serving domestic bans, Tottenham have no players who are suspended for this match.
